Articles of nuget

¿Usando NuGet con múltiples mejores prácticas de desarrollo de canalizaciones?

Estamos implementando NuGet (aunque lentamente), pero nos encontramos con un problema y estoy tratando de no abandonar NuGet. Nuestro nuevo process de desarrollo tiene un entorno DEV con múltiples tuberías en las que se trabaja. Necesitamos una manera de aislar los cambios de código en una sola tubería. En este momento, si Branch 1 publica […]

Paquete nuget nested

Mi problema es un poco complicado, espero poder explicarlo bien. Hay 2 dlls de interoperabilidad que son dlls de un producto y uno es para V10 y otro es V16. Let lo llama "MyComDll" Tengo un proyecto llamado MyWrapper que usa MyComDll. En TFS, quiero crear nugetpage para V10 y V16. Esto está bien, puedo […]

No se pudo cargar el file o ensamblado 'Ninject versión 4.0.0.0

Hay un problema con la reference de ensamblaje, se adivina al actualizar los packages nuget. Comienzo desde un proyecto que no tiene dependencia de la mayoría de las dependencies (sorting topológica) reinstalé todos los packages nuget e incremento la versión en el file nuspec y todos los files de packages.config referencedos a Ninject 3.2.2.0 <package […]

nuget y control de fuente?

Recuerdo que nuget no funcionaba como esperaba, así que no lo incluí en mi control de fuente. Pero, ¿hay alguna manera de hacerlo funcionar? Intenté probar el problema. Parece que si elimino mi bin y la carpeta de objects para mi proyecto no puedo comstackr ningún problema. Sin embargo, si elimino esos y los dlls […]

La actualización del package NuGet causa un error de control de fuente porque los files de contenido no se sobrescriben

Con bastante frecuencia, al instalar algunos de los packages de biblioteca js * nuget copy los files js en el directory Scripts del proyecto web y pone estos files bajo control de fuente. Sin embargo, al actualizar el package en lugar de simplemente reescribir los files nuget primero los elimina y luego copy las versiones […]

Utilizar Entity Framework en Visual Studio Team Services Project Source Control

Estoy usando Visual Studio Team Services con otro miembro del proyecto. Queremos utilizar Entity Framework en nuestro proyecto Visual Studio Team Services, así que creé nuestro proyecto e instalé Entity Framework a través de Nuget Package Manager y "Checked-In" para convertir los files en TFVC Source Control. Todo funciona bien en mi máquina, pero cuando […]

Emitir packages de Nuget desde proyectos abiertos desde el control de código fuente

Estoy desarrollando un proyecto abierto desde el control de fuente. Tengo una copy local para editar y estoy confirmando mis cambios en el server donde se guarda el proyecto. También instalé el package PagedList.Mvc Nuget. En este momento traté de crear un nuevo proyecto desde el mismo control de fuente desde la misma PC, pero […]

Visual Studio – ¿Cómo agregar una biblioteca no nuger para que pueda funcionar con el control de fuente (tfs) y no haga reference al file local?

Estoy trabajando en un proyecto de Xamarin en Visual Studio. Para este proyecto, quiero usar cierta biblioteca. Sin embargo, no parece que el package Nuget para esta biblioteca. Cuando descargo la biblioteca puedo agregar su .dll al proyecto, pero me temo que esto no funcionará correctamente con el control de fuente, ya que la reference […]

¿Debo agregar todos los packages desde Nuget al control de fuente TFS si deseo una configuration de CI?

Estoy usando el service de Team Foundation con Git, y me di count de que cuando revisé mi código por primera vez, no se incluyeron todos los dlls en la carpeta de packages. 1) Si quiero configurar CI en la nube, ¿tendría que include todos estos packages nuget en el control de fuente? 2) Si […]

Copia de security del package Nuget

Ha sido una práctica común verificar los packages nuget utilizados en una solución en el control de fuente. Con la nueva característica de restauración de packages de Nuget 1.6, ya no es necesario verificar los packages en el control de código fuente. Sin embargo, esto hace que sus proyectos dependan de nuget.org. Puede llegar el […]